COURSE OBJECTIVES:

In this course, students learn the tools and skills that will allow them to:
 Assess a company’s sustainable competitive advantage
 Analyze industries and competitors
 Develop and implement strategies that enable companies to consistently
outperform competition.

The course will introduce appropriate analytical tools and concepts with hands-on
exercises and real-life applications.
